Exhaust Fan Replacement in Denver County, CO
Exhaust fan replacement services involve removing an existing exhaust fan and installing a new unit to ensure proper ventilation in areas such as bathrooms, kitchens, or laundry rooms. These projects typically address issues like poor airflow, excessive humidity, or malfunctioning fans that no longer operate efficiently. Property owners often seek this service to improve indoor air quality, reduce moisture buildup, and prevent mold growth, especially in spaces prone to high humidity. Before requesting exhaust fan replacement, it’s helpful to understand the size and type of fan needed for the specific space, as well as any compatibility requirements with existing electrical wiring or venting systems.
Homeowners should consider factors such as the fan’s airflow capacity, noise level, and energy efficiency when selecting a replacement. It’s also important to assess whether the current venting system is in good condition or if additional modifications are necessary. Proper installation ensures the new fan functions correctly and maintains proper ventilation. Contacting a professional for guidance can help determine the most suitable unit for the property’s needs and ensure the replacement process is completed safely and effectively.

Exhaust Fan Replacement Questions
What are signs that an exhaust fan needs replacement? Unusual noises, persistent odors, or reduced airflow can indicate the fan is failing and may need replacement.
Can existing wiring be reused when replacing an exhaust fan? It depends on the condition and compatibility; electrical components should be evaluated to ensure safety and proper operation.
Is it necessary to replace the entire exhaust fan or just parts? Often, individual parts can be replaced, but if the fan is outdated or damaged, a full replacement may be recommended.
What types of exhaust fans are suitable for different rooms? There are various models designed for bathrooms, kitchens, or laundry rooms, chosen based on the room size and ventilation needs.
